Why this layer matters
Hospitals do not need another isolated tool. They need a connected surgical layer.
Modern surgery generates live procedural context, specialist decisions, documentation, teaching moments, and long-term review value. Most institutions still manage these signals across disconnected systems.
Surgery is disconnected
Video, decisions, teaching, and follow-up rarely live in one institutional workflow.
Expertise does not scale on its own
Mentoring, proctoring, and first-case support still depend too heavily on physical presence.
Hospitals need evidence, not just recordings
Cases must become searchable, reusable, and operationally valuable across care, learning, and review.
